Small bytes vs long form

With time, the user preferences are changing. Unlike old days, now they are more interested in reading, sharing and re-sharing content that’s short, crispy and most importantly visually appealing.

It doesn’t mean that in-depth content has lost its importance to content that appeals to both Google and people. It’s still Google’s favorite, but user preferences have changed. They have started liking snackable content.

Snackable content = Content which is short, easy to read, visually engaging, and shareable.

  1. Vine

Shooting a 5-minute video might seem a long haul, but what about a six-second clip? Vine is a Twitter-owned video sharing app that allows users to watch and share looping six-second-long video clips.   1. GIFs

Though GIF have been around since 1987, it is only recently that they have come up as a rage in designing snackable content. Because of its witty appeal, it has become one of the most shareable content formats now. Not to mention, Facebook and WhatsApp have integrated GIF in their messenger platforms for a reason, which is but its rising popularity among users of all age groups.

  1. Images

Pinterest is solely dependent on graphical content, yet it has a user base of more than 100 million. More so, the valuation of Pinterest goes past $11 billion. Pinterest is not alone when it comes to building an image-centric billion-dollar business. Instagram is another social media content platform that gets over 100 million page views and is getting bigger and bigger with time.
